Meadows Lake -Rules

    • Fishing strictly by prior booking only. When arriving at the site (no earlier than 9:00) enter the gate (using code emailed to you a week prior to arrival) and park in the main car park, you can walk around the lake. A draw will be held in the main car park at 10:00.
    • Slings, water mats nets and water buckets will be provided – anybody caught with their own equipment will be asked to leave immediately without refund. No personal fish care equipment shall be brought on to the premises. Fish safety is of paramount importance.
    • A fifty-pound deposit for Carp care equipment for each angler will be collected from the lead angler either as cash in an envelope upon arrival or bank transfer on the day before arrival. Carp care equipment will be handed back and inspected for damage between 9 and 10 on the day of departure, any damages will be paid for, and the remaining deposit returned. If deposit was bank transferred it will be returned within 24hr of receipt of your bank details
    • All equipment (reels and line, weights, boats etc ) must be dry when arriving on site.
    • No fish are to be removed from the water at any time, please unhook, weigh and photograph all captures in the water and ensure your equipment is available by the waterside ready for use. Fish can be large to ask an adjacent angler for assistance.
    • Carp may be held in a large recovery sling to assist weighing and photographing – the maximum time should not exceed 10 mins. No carp to be placed in a sack.
    • Minimum age is 20 years for any exceptions please call to discuss.
    • No non-angling guests permitted on the fishery.
    • No solid or inflatable boats to be brought on the premises.
    • 3 rod maximum.
    • No braided mainline, naked chod rigs or leadcore.
    • No Twig rigs
    • Minimum of 1 meter tubing or manufacturer prepared leaders i.e. Safezone, Fox etc. to be used
    • Pellets and suitably prepared Particles may be used in moderation.
    • No bait boats unless you’re on a lake exclusive booking then its up to the person who booked.
    • Micro-barbed hooks only with maximum size 4.
    • Maximum lead size of 4oz.
    • Minimum line strength of 15lb inc. Zigs.
    • Strictly no Maggots
    • No artificial (plastic) bait
    • Fishing is allowed from designated swims only. Please do not damage the vegetation.
    • No dogs allowed.
    • No rods to be left unattended (unofficial 40m remote rule applies however please be aware that this could lead to you being in trouble with the Environment Agency).
    • Always respect other anglers and do not cast into adjacent swims.
    • No fires. You may use BBQ’s but please ensure these are placed on bricks or slabs provided, do not place directly on the grass
    • Badly damaged fish must be retained in a sling and reported to the emergency numbers immediately.
    • Fish care treatments should be used on all hook holds marks, damaged fins etc.
    • Your ticket permits fishing on the date of arrival. You must leave the fishery no later than 9:30 on your day of departure.
